If it has a real time clock feature such as found in pokémon ruby version or sapphire version, it is supposed to have a battery, if it doesn't have one, it's a fake. For gba pokemon games, only ruby and sapphire use batteries, so if you have another pokemon game with a battery, again, it’s almost definitely a fake. Web if your cartridge is missing at least one chip labelled mx, it’s almost definitely a fake. If your game has a battery inside, and it doesn't have a real time clock feature it's a fake.
